About red light therapy

Red light therapy, also known as low-level light therapy or photobiomodulation, is a natural treatment that uses low-level red or near-infrared light to stimulate the body's cells and promote healing. This therapy can be administered using various devices, including handheld devices, lamps, and full-body beds.

Red light therapy uses light to help your body heal and feel better. It works by shining a special light on your skin or the affected area. This light is absorbed by the cells, enhancing their function by boosting the mitochondria—the cells' powerhouses—to produce more energy. Increased cellular energy can reduce inflammation and improve overall bodily functions. Red light therapy is generally safe with few side effects. If you're interested, consult a healthcare provider and follow usage instructions carefully.

Red light therapy primarily works by stimulating the mitochondria in cells to produce more ATP (adenosine triphosphate), the primary energy source for cells. Increased ATP production can lead to reduced inflammation and improved cellular function. This is particularly beneficial for muscle and joint pain, as well as skin conditions like acne and rosacea.

Scientific studies on red light therapy have shown promising results. For instance, research indicates that red light therapy can effectively reduce muscle and joint pain and improve skin conditions such as acne and rosacea. While more research is needed to fully understand its mechanisms and benefits, red light therapy is generally considered safe with minimal side effects, such as mild eye irritation or light sensitivity.
